Tamarind is a motor yacht with an overall length of m. The yacht's builder is R.A. Newman & Sons from United Kingdom, who launched Tamarind in 1958. The superyacht has a beam of m, a draught of m and a volume of GT.
Tamarind features exterior design by Frederick R Parker, with naval architecture by Frederick R Parker.
Up to 7 guests can be accommodated on board the superyacht, Tamarind, and she also has accommodation for 5 crew members, including the ship's captain. Tamarind has a wood hull and an aluminium superstructure. She is powered by 2 Gardner engines, which give her a top speed of kn. The yacht carries litres of fuel on board.
